First, his place has excellent ambiance for a romantic date night or a quiet birthday celebration! We started our evening with a founder's margarita with a blackberry smash. Both drinks were very delicious and made to perfection. We also had the delicious skillet cornbread with whipped butter. My husband selected the bacon wrapped pork tenderloin, and had the rainbow trout with truffle fries. The pork tenderloin was very tender and juicy. The corn salsa with balsamic vinegar topped on the mashed potatoes were a perfect balance. The Rainbow trout with green beans was amazing! Wasn't sure if I would enjoy it, but I took a gamble and was pleasantly suprised with how delicious the browned butter and lemon added amazing flavor to it. For dessert, we chose the vanilla bean creme brulee, and we were not disappointed. The crust was toasted perfectly and didn't have that burnt taste that you sometimes get with creme brulee. Overall, this was an amazing meal, and I look forward to coming back!

I came here to celebrate my birthday and my FIL’s. I’ve been here several times and always get the ribeye. Again, this time, I got the ribeye and OMG, still mouthwatering as the first time! However, I also ordered the trout entree this time too and it was such a good portion size and very delicious. I think the lentil salad is a hit or miss depending on if the diner likes lentils. I’m actually a big fan. This time was also the first time I ordered creamed spinach. We typically always get the mashed potatoes and corn. But wow, that creamed spinach is so delicious- super homemade tasting. You can even tell they use fresh spinach because the leaves are large (not like those small frozen leaves). Really delicious- I wish I ordered some for to-go!
Of course, we got happy birthday desserts and I ordered a huckleberry bread pudding. If you love bread pudding, you will be blown away! It was the perfect balance of sweet and tangy and the vanilla sauce is so perfect.
Service was top -notch. William was patient and professional and prompt with everything. It couldn’t have been a better evening.
